Oscar 2026 Nominees Announced: Who Will Compete for the Statuette

The ceremony will take place on March 15
The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ences has announced the nominees for the 2026 Academy Awards. This year’s 98th Oscars ceremony — one of the most prestigious events in the world of cinema — will be held on March 15 and promises to be a standout occasion, marked by both a strong lineup of favorites and several new records.
The clear frontrunner in terms of potential wins is Ryan Coogler’s Sinners, which received an impressive 16 nominations. Close behind is One Battle After Another with 13 nominations, while Marty Supreme earned 10 nods.

Among this year’s updates is the introduction of a new category, Best Casting, launched by the Academy for the first time.
Nominees for the 2026 Academy Awards
Best Picture
- Bugonia
- F1
- Frankenstein
- Hamnet
- Marty Supreme
- One Battle After Another
- The Secret Agent
- Sentimental Value
- Sinners
- Train Dreams

Best Actress
- Jessie Buckley — Hamnet
- Rose Byrne — I’m Not Made of Iron
- Kate Hudson — A Love Song
- Renate Reinsve — Sentimental Value
- Emma Stone — Bugonia

Best Actor
- Leonardo DiCaprio — One Battle After Another
- Ethan Hawke — Blue Moon
- Michael B. Jordan — Sinners
- Wagner Moura — The Secret Agent
- Timothée Chalamet — Marty Supreme

Best Supporting Actress
- Elle Fanning — Sentimental Value
- Inga Ibsdotter Lilleaas — Sentimental Value
- Amy Madigan — Weapons
- Wunmi Mosaku — Sinners
- Tayana Taylor — One Battle After Another
Best Supporting Actor
- Benicio del Toro — One Battle After Another
- Jacob Elordi — Frankenstein
- Delroy Lindo — Sinners
- Stellan Skarsgård — Sentimental Value
- Sean Penn — One Battle After Another

Best Director
- Paul Thomas Anderson — One Battle After Another
- Ryan Coogler — Sinners
- Josh Safdie — Marty Supreme
- Joachim Trier — Sentimental Value
- Chloé Zhao — Hamnet
